Antlers American
May 13, 1926
Bevans News


Mothers Day was observed at Bevans with a Sunday School program and dinner on the grounds. Singing and preaching was held in the afternoon.

About half of the pupils were absent from school Monday. They were afraid of catching the mumps.

We only had one day of school last week. Our teacher, Miss Edna Fleming, was ill with the mumps. We are glad that she is able to be in school this week.

May 20, 1926
Bevans Items


We had no school here Thursday and Friday on account of Miss Fleming holding examinations. Annie and Edith Ballard, Lewis Poe, Marney Snow, and Jewell Mae Fleming took the examinations on Oklahoma History.

Misses Edna Fleming and Clara Gilstrap went to Antlers Friday night to witness the senior play.

Jewell Mae Fleming left Friday for her home. We regret to lose her.


Friendship News

Nellie Fleming spent Sunday evening with Jewell Fleming.

Mr. and Mrs. Alvin McConnell spent Sunday with Mr. and Mrs. Bud Boyett.

Miss Jewell Fleming has returned from Bevans where she has been attending school the past term.

Mr. and Mrs. Curtis Clark, of Rattan, spent Sunday with Mr. and Mrs. Tom Fleming.
